			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The goal of most businesses, when it comes to their website, if to have their site listed near or at the top of search engine results pages.  And when it comes to search engines, Google is the top dog.  Climbing to the top of the Google ranking can be an arduous journey, but there are ways to make the trek easier, and sometimes faster.  Today we’re going to talk about tips that can improve your Google rankings and optimize your search engine presence.</p>
<p><img class="alignleft size-medium wp-image-481" title="google1" src="http://naperville-webdesign.net/wp-content/uploads/2010/08/google1-300x161.jpg" alt="" width="300" height="161" />The first thing that you have to understand about Google is that the site is primarily based on keywords, both in the main text of the page as well as text that’s imbedded it what is called the meta portion of your page, the area that isn’t visible to anyone but programmers and search engines.  The idea is to put accurate and unique keywords in your page so that when Google is searching, your site pops up.  So in the content of your page, make sure you include key words and phrases that reference your business or your location of both.  For example, Systemtek uses the phrase “<a href="http://www.systemtek.net">Naperville Web Design</a>” in numerous location because it maximizes our presence.  Potential customers often search for the type of business they are looking for as well as the area that they live in, so always be very specific when it comes to keywords and phrases.  List specific services and products that you provide.  Make sure you cover all your bases.  You want to make sure that a customer will see that you indeed provide what they are looking for.</p>
<p>One important thing to remember is that Google may go on keywords, but it also is designed to protect users from spam.  When you are considering the content for your page, don’t overuse the keywords.  A good rule of thumb is that for every 400 words on the page, 1-2% should be keywords.  This will ensure that you have the necessary means for being found in Google, but your page isn’t so oversaturated in keywords that Google will consider you spam and block you.  So be careful and have an even hand when it comes to including keywords.</p>
<p>Another tool at your disposal to move you up in the Google rankings is links.  On your page, link to other pages.  If you have a blog, link to it.  If you have a partner with a website, link to it and have them link to you.  Links provide more content for Google to read, and well named links are even better.  Rather than saying “Click <a href="http://www.naperville-webdesign.net">HERE</a> for more tips,” you would want to say “<a href="http://www.naperville-webdesign.net">More SEO Tips and Tricks</a>.”  That link does double duty, since it is both a link AND a key phrase for the business.  The more, well-named links, the better.</p>
<p>The last tip today is to get your site listed on online directories.  Do a little research on your own and find out if there are directories for business like yours.  Often you’ll find that there are places that will list your site for free or ask only that you put an icon on your page that will link back to the main site.  There are a lot of options to explore.  Just make sure you choose the right directory.  Again, do your research and make sure you’re not going to be balled up with a bunch of spam companies.  The name of the game is caution and care when it comes to SEO.</p>
<p>There are a lot of little things you can do to move your business up in the Google rankings.  The three we listed here are the biggest, and if you follow these directions you’ll see your page start climbing.  It takes some time, so be patient.  Just remember to keep everything well organized and don’t overuse the keywords, links, and directories and over time your business will show up in the first page when you Google yourself.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p class="MsoNormal">Testimonials are one of the simplest and easiest marketing tools available to a business owner.<span> </span>Most of the work is done by the customer, and you, as the business owner, get to reap the benefits.<span> </span>But how do you use testimonials effectively and make them work for you?<span> </span>In this article, we will address three questions about testimonials and try to clear up some of the foggier areas.</p>
<h4 class="MsoNormal">1. <span> </span>What can testimonials do for me?</h4>
<p class="MsoNormal">Testimonials are a great way to spread the word about your business.<span> </span>The content comes from consumers, rather than the business itself, so there isn’t an implied bias.<span> </span>Potential customers can read the testimonials and see how like-minded consumers felt about the service or product you provided.<span> </span>Testimonials are a way to promote yourself without having to promote yourself.<span> </span></p>
<h3 class="MsoNormal"><a href="http://naperville-webdesign.net/wp-content/uploads/2010/07/review.jpg"><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-430" title="Google review for Systemtek" src="http://naperville-webdesign.net/wp-content/uploads/2010/07/review.jpg" alt="review" width="330" height="248" /></a></h3>
<h4 class="MsoNormal">2.<span> </span>How do I get testimonials?</h4>
<p class="MsoNormal">There are a number of ways to get testimonials from customers.<span> </span>The simplest way is to just ask them.<span> </span>Many happy customers are more than willing to put down their satisfaction in writing.<span> </span>If you don’t want to come right out and ask for a glowing review, you can ask customers to complete satisfaction surveys.<span> </span>These are a little less invasive, as you aren’t specifically asking them to write a paragraph about your company, only to rate their satisfaction and write something only if they care to.<span> </span>You can also check online review sites, like Google reviews or Yelp.<span> </span>You may find that people have already written a testimonial without you even having to ask them.</p>
<p class="MsoNormal">On a side note, don’t offer incentives for customers to give good reviews.<span> </span>They will feel forced and insincere.<span> </span>Instead, if a customer gives you a good review, send them a coupon or another promotional item as a thank you after the fact.</p>
<p class="MsoNormal"><span> </span><span> </span></p>
<h4 class="MsoNormal">3.<span> </span>What do I do with the testimonial now that I have it?</h4>
<p><a href="http://www.systemtek.net/testimonial.htm"><img class="size-full wp-image-421 alignright" title="Systemtek's Testimonial Page" src="http://naperville-webdesign.net/wp-content/uploads/2010/07/testimonial.jpg" alt="testimonial" width="330" height="248" /></a></p>
<p class="MsoNormal"><span> </span>Display it!<span> </span>If you have a website, put it on the homepage.<span> </span>If you have the means, have an entire page on your website dedicated to testimonials.<span> </span>They are an invaluable resource to you and your company.<span> </span>You can also post them on your Facebook page, put them on print advertising.<span> </span>Use them in any way you see fit.  For an example of how to present testimonials, check out <a title="Systemtek Testimonials" href="http://www.systemtek.net/testimonial.htm">Systemtek&#8217;s testimonial page here</a>.<span> </span></p>
<p class="MsoNormal"><span> </span>At this point, it’s necessary to talk about some of the unwritten rules of testimonials.<span> </span>As we said before, you don’t want your testimonials to sound insincere.<span> </span>So make sure you pick just the right examples to display.<span> </span>You want them to be positive, but if they are too over the top, they won’t be believable and potential customers will think you wrote them yourself.<span> </span></p>
<p class="MsoNormal">Also, don’t edit testimonials too much.<span> </span>You can run into the problem of a prior customer reading what they wrote and getting upset because you cut out some possibly negative things.<span> </span>If you aren’t sure if you’ve edited it too much, don’t use it.<span> </span>And don’t ever write a fake testimonial yourself.<span> </span>They will come across as fake and that’s not good for you.<span> </span>Finally, give credit to the customer, with their permission of course.<span> </span>If you don’t have written permission, maintain their anonymity by only using their initials and not giving their location or business.<span> </span>You don’t want to get in trouble because you used someone’s words without their consent.</p>
<p class="MsoNormal"><span> </span>Testimonials can do a lot of work for you if you use them right.<span> </span>Follow the tips we’ve outlined above to maximize the usefulness of them and grow your business.<span> </span>Just remember to be ethical.<span> </span></p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p class="MsoNormal" style="margin: 0in 0in 10pt;"><span style="font-family: Calibri; font-size: small;">On the internet, just as in person, the first impression can make or break your business.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;">  </span>Imagine walking past a store and the outside is falling apart, and the little bit you can see inside is no better.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;">  </span>Odd are, you won’t be shopping at that particular business.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;">  </span>On the internet, your website is your store, and making sure that the outside looks as good as the inside is important.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;">  </span>It’s vital to your business to make that person’s first experience with your website a positive one.</span></p>
<p class="MsoNormal" style="margin: 0in 0in 10pt;"><span style="font-size: small;"><span style="font-family: Calibri;"><a href="http://naperville-webdesign.net/wp-content/uploads/2010/06/screenshot1.bmp"><img class="size-full wp-image-392 alignleft" title="screenshot1" src="http://naperville-webdesign.net/wp-content/uploads/2010/06/screenshot1.bmp" alt="screenshot1" /></a>The initial contact your customer is going to have with your business will most likely be on a search engine.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;">  </span>A potential customer will search the internet for a particular service, and you obviously want your business to be near the top.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;">  </span>Customers are much more likely to visit a site that is in the top five on a search than one that may be buried further down the list.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;">  </span>So making sure that your website has good placement in an engine is imperative.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;">  </span><a href="http://www.systemtek.net/services.htm">Search engine optimization companies</a> specialize in helping businesses customize their website in order to give them better positioning on search engine results.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;">  </span>So enlisting the help of an <a href="http://www.systemtek.net">SEO company</a> can help drive more business.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;">  </span>Additionally, your company name, as well as additional information that pops up on a search will help business.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;">  </span>Make sure that your site has key words attached to the site name so that potential customers know that your business specializes in what they are looking for.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;">  </span></span></span></p>
<p class="MsoNormal" style="margin: 0in 0in 10pt;"><span style="font-size: small;"><span style="font-family: Calibri;"></span></span><span style="font-size: small;"><span style="font-family: Calibri;"><a href="http://naperville-webdesign.net/wp-content/uploads/2010/06/homepage.bmp"><img class="alignright size-full wp-image-395" title="homepage" src="http://naperville-webdesign.net/wp-content/uploads/2010/06/homepage.bmp" alt="homepage" width="407" height="232" /></a>Once a possible customer clicks on your link, the first thing they will see is the homepage.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;">  </span>This is going to be their first real experience with your company, so it’s important that the homepage is a good representation of not only your company, but of your target customer.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;">  </span>Make sure that the site content reflects what you want your customer to think of your company.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;">  </span>Have an image in mind of your company, whether it’s sleek and stylish or warm and inviting, and have a website that reflects that image.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;">  </span>Like a good first sentence in a book, a good homepage will keep the viewer interested and will compel them to stay and explore.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;">  </span></span></span></p>
<p class="MsoNormal" style="margin: 0in 0in 10pt;"><span style="font-size: small;"><span style="font-family: Calibri;">Finally, in addition to the layout and theme of the homepage, make sure to keep the first site current.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;">  </span>Whether it be through a daily message and weekly blog or monthly specials, it’s important for customers to know that you are maintaining the site.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;">  </span>Like a rundown store front, an unmaintained homepage gives potential customers the impression of a faltering business.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;">  </span>Show your presence to your customers so they know that you care as much about the appearance of your company and website as you will about their business.</span></span></p>
<p class="MsoNormal" style="margin: 0in 0in 10pt;"><span style="font-size: small;"><span style="font-family: Calibri;">You can never make another first impression, so make sure it’s a good one.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;">  </span>From search engine results to image to upkeep, a potential customer is going to judge your business on the first few clicks into your site, so make sure that those few clicks are memorable.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;">  </span>It will help drive business and keep people coming back for more. </span></span></p>

<p>Are you a mortgage broker, lawyer, financial advisor or a plumber? Did you know a service business can significantly increase leads and customer loyalty by an effective website? Does your service business website generate leads and bring customers? If not, I&#8217;ll explain what went wrong.</p>
<h3>1. Your website does not look professional</h3>
<p>Your homepage is the first impression of your business that you give to your potential customers online. One main reason people visit a service business website, is to see if the company is trustworthy. According to a 2006 web user survey, 60% of people don&#8217;t trust businesses with poorly designed websites. If you give wrong the impression to your potential customers, they will leave and visit your competitor&#8217;s website. A professional look and feel gives your potential customers assurance of your credibility. Once a visitor opens your site, your business is judged for better or worse. What impression does your website give?</p>
<h3>2. Your website contents are out of date</h3>
<p>When did you last modify your website content? Is your website still advertising last year&#8217;s events? How efficiently does your homepage flow into your detailed service pages? How effectively do you introduce your services on your web pages?</p>
<p>When your potential clients visit your website, they are expecting to find answers for their questions. If you give them outdated information or fail to express your service details effectively, you can&#8217;t expect leads from them. You may also give a poor impression of your business.</p>
<h3>3. You didn&#8217;t market your website</h3>
<p>Unlike your actual business building, your website may not be visible to your customers. You may have heard about search engine marketing and website optimization. If you are not a computer geek or don&#8217;t have time to learn about HTML, try to focus on off-line marketing. Try to put your website address on every possible marketing collateral, such as your business cards and direct mail.</p>
<h3>4. Your website doesn&#8217;t encourage visitors to take action</h3>
<p>Action could be a call for free consultation, signing up for a newsletter or sending an e-mail to request a quote. If you have a great looking website with useful content for website visitors, you should try to convert them into customers. Try to put action items on every page with some urgency. People usually don&#8217;t react when there is no urgency.</p>
<h3>5. You never measure the effectiveness</h3>
<p>Do you know how many leads are generated through your website? And how many leads turn into real customers? If you know how effective your website is, you can enhance your website to improve in the future.</p>
<p>Impress your visitors with a positive and professional business image. Even if they don t become your customers right away, impressed visitors can soon become your customers.</p>

<p>Now that you have a great <a title="Naperville Website Design" href="http://systemtek.net">new web design</a> for your company, you want to make sure people are actually visiting it. There are many ways to attract people to your website besides waiting on your search engine optimization efforts to bring you to the top of Google. Depending on your business, some methods of bringing more visitors to your website might be better than others. Here are a few ways we recommend driving more traffic to your website.</p>
<p><strong>Social Media</strong></p>
<p>The verdict is out: you need to be involved in the social media community! Remember, your goal with social media should be to get people to visit your actual website. By getting involved in the conversation on sites like Twitter and Facebook, you can discuss relevant information with people and start to develop groups that all share the same interest. Getting involved may take some time, but social media will only help your business as much as you let it. Facebook also has advertising functions that might allow your company the right exposure. It all depends on the market you are trying to attract and how many of them are using Facebook.</p>
<p><strong>Blog</strong></p>
<p>By having a blog for your company and updating it frequently, your website will have new, fresh content that the search engines like to see. Maybe more importantly though, you are sharing valuable information with people out there that you want to visit your website. You should also find other people&#8217;s blogs that have relevant information for your company. By following them, you will learn more useful tips and stay on top of the latest trends. It is a good idea to post comments on other blogs too, because that will get you involved in the conversation and help you grow valuable relationships. Some blogs even allow you to leave a link going back to your main website. Make sure your comments are of value though, because writing &#8220;Great post!&#8221; will not make people want to click on the link you provided for your website.</p>
<p><strong>Google Adwords</strong></p>
<p>Google is a powerful way to attract people to your website, even if your SEO doesn&#8217;t have you at the top of the keyword search results. By setting up Adwords for your company, you have the freedom to list your online advertisements how you want to. Your ad will appear at the top or the side of the search results page, in the area that says &#8220;Sponsored Links&#8221;. Adwords allows you to customize the ad, pay as much as you want to each month and make your advertisements appear for the keywords that you want. By using these targeted keywords, you can run very cost effective advertising online.</p>
<p>Other ways to get involved in online conversations and develop groups of people to communicate with include online article submitting sites like ezine.com, press releases and forums. There are a lot of people blogging and communicating on forums online. Start out by finding a few that are worth following and try adding a couple each week. By staying in contact with more and more people, you can watch the number of visitors to your site grow.</p>

<p>With the search engine and search advertising partnership in the works between Yahoo! and Microsoft, how much will your website have to adapt to a growing number of users trying to find you on something other than Google? Yahoo will soon incorporate Microsoft&#8217;s Bing technology as its default search engine, giving the pair almost 30% market share in US searches versus Google&#8217;s 65%.</p>
<p>So what does this mean for the effort you&#8217;ve put into making sure your <a title="Systemtek Web Design" href="http://www.systemtek.net">creative web design</a> stays on top of the search results? With Bing taking over Yahoo Search, it is going to be important for webmasters to be aware of the importance of Bing in the future. While optimizing for Bing is generally a good idea anyway, those who see a good deal of traffic from Yahoo! are going to have to make sure they pay attention to their Bing results now. Once the switch comes next year, your Yahoo Search results aren&#8217;t going to matter as much as your Bing ones.</p>
<p>The differences between ranking well in Google and in Bing are luckily not too far apart, but there are a few things that Bing holds more important. Domain age seems to play a stronger role in the search results for Bing, as well as the amount of text on your website. Unlike Google however, blogs linked to your website aren&#8217;t quite as important as on Google.</p>
